In this episode of "Faith Forward: Innovating Legacy Inspired by Dr. Evelyn Bethune," we delve into the transformative power of blending tradition with innovation. Join us as we explore the insights shared by Dr. Evelyn Bethune, granddaughter of the legendary Dr. Mary McLeod Bethune, a trailblazer who redefined American education with just $1.50 and unyielding faith. Discover how true legacy isn't about preserving the past like a museum artifact but advancing it with courage and creativity. Learn from modern examples like the Cite Black Women Collective and DVRGNT Ventures, who use today's tools to amplify their missions. Challenge yourself to rethink how you honor your heritage by embracing new methods and technologies, ensuring your impact is as bold and far-reaching as those who came before you.
